MGBL High School League Enjoys Championship Weekend

On Saturday night, June 18, the semi-finals were held at the Jewish Center of Teaneck and Ben Porat Yosef. After three of the four quarterfinal games went into overtime the week before, the fans came ready for more hard-fought, competitive games.

At the Jewish Center, Embroidme took an early lead on two quick three’s from Eli Sudwerts. Ikey Gutlove hit the second of two free throws to tie the game at 23 with five seconds to play in the first half. Embroidme coach Dani Bendheim called timeout and drew up a beautiful play that was executed to perfection, setting his son, Charlie Bendheim (team high 20 points), up for a jump shot that gave Embroidme a 25-23 lead going into the half. The second half was back and forth with neither team able to widen the gap by more than three baskets, but as the clock expired on regulation both teams were tied at 51. Overtime was dominated by the Sharsheret boys, juniors Shmuel Bak and Stevie Paul lead the way with 23 points apiece and Sharsheret advanced to play another day.

Meanwhile at Ben Porat Yosef, B-I-L Office Furniture was facing THESHPIELMANS.COM team. THESHPIELMANS.COM was still riding an emotional overtime win over the heavily favored Akari Therapeutics Plc team the week before, and came out with a balanced attack (six of their nine players scoring in the first half). Yosef Damski lead B-I-L with 16 points in the half and when the first half ended, the score was 24-24. In the second half, B-I-L’s Dovi Koenigsberg paced his team with eight points, but on the strength of two threes from Pesach Abrahams the scoreboard showed 45-45 when the buzzer sounded. In overtime, Abrahams nailed another late three, but B-I-L’s Hudy Weiss answered back with a three of his own. The game was tied at 49 and another overtime looked eminent, until Nechemiah Gross was fouled and hit two foul shots with one second on the clock to seal the game and the victory for B-I-L.

Less than 24 hours later, the two teams met back at Ben Porat Yosef for the championship game. B-I-L came out firing on all cylinders, despite the absence of coach Stan Potash. Yosef Damski had another strong first half scoring 13 points, while Dovi (aka Russell Westbrook) Koenigsberg was dishing and swishing scoring eight points, while finding countless teammates en route to the hoop. Sharsheret coach Nachi Paul was looking for championship number three on the day (two of his teams won in YYL earlier), but his team was having a hard time getting the ball to fall through the net. After countless Sharsheret in and outs and unfriendly rolls, B-I-L looked like they were going to break the string of overtime games as they took a 37-19 lead into the half. The second half was more of the same. Sharsheret’s Stevie Paul lead all scorers with 20 points, but the balanced scoring of Nechemiah Gross and Dovi Koenigsberg proved to be too much to handle as they cruised to a 66-41 victory. After the game, Dovi Koenigsberg picked up his second consecutive MGBL High School MVP award.
